Before promoting build 4.12 of the Lanternway admin dashboard, verify dark-mode rendering across the settings, billing, and audit panels. Toggle the theme via the preferences flag service, not local storage, so the change propagates to all sessions. Confirm contrast ratios pass the automated sweep and that chart legends remain legible. The theme flag service sits behind internal auth; rollbacks require the same credential. Authenticate your promotion request using the release key provided below.

app token of yajeg-kawef = kto11_7En3XSX8xQw

Plugin authors integrating with the Bramblewick assignment service should never cache bucket decisions locally; assignments can be reshuffled when an experiment is paused or its traffic split changes. Always call the assignment endpoint at session start and honor the returned TTL. Before testing against the sandbox tier, confirm your plugin loads the following configuration values exactly as listed.

service settings:
[casax]
port = 6379
team = rusir
host = casax.zemvarhq.corp
region = outer-4
access_code = ac_9808ce
timeout_ms = 1500

Ticket #— Missed pick-up: archival film reels, Brindlemoor Archive. The courier from Larkspan Freight did not arrive Tuesday for the six reel canisters staged in the cold room. Reels remain climate-stable but must ship this week. A replacement run is booked for Thursday morning; the hand-over instruction appears below.

handover note for yagef-bagep: the drudor pelius courier leaves the kasdor zorvan norir ledger at gate 8016 under passcode 755406